Transponder Chip Keys
The majority of cars built in the last 20 years are equipped with keys that have a transponder chip in it. This is an excellent security feature that makes it much more difficult for someone to use a hot wire in your car and start it. However, it does not stop from happening completely, however, as they have also found new ways to get into vehicles despite this added layer of security.
The key is equipped with a microchip that communicates to the car's computer once it is placed inside the ignition lock cylinder. The key is then able begin the car and deactivate its normal immobilizer.
The chip also contains information on who the owner is so that it cannot be used by someone other than the owner to start the vehicle. If you have lost or stolen your transponder keys It is recommended to replace it as soon as you are able by an automotive locksmith. They will program the chip.

Keyless Entry to Vehicles
Modern Suzuki cars often use keys that look like a remote control. It also comes with advanced security features. These keys have an internal transponder that has to be programmed to allow the start of the vehicle. The keys need to be taken to a dealer or an automotive locksmith that has the proper key programming equipment to work on them.
The keys of this type also include an LF field to determine whether the user is within or outside of the vehicle when the key is hit. This is to ensure that the vehicle cannot be started while somebody is playing with it at a petrol station for instance. The LF fields must be strong enough to be read however, there should be an overshoot in order for the signal to reach around things such as windows.
